Abstract

Abstract

En 中文
In this paper, we address the problem of learning time-varying graph models from spatiotemporal signals by jointly capturing spatial and temporal dependencies. Existing graph learning methods are predominantly centralized, resulting in high computational costs for large-scale data, while distributed methods that consider only spatial correlations face limitations in handling dynamic signals. To overcome these challenges, a novel distributed graph learning algorithm is proposed, which leverages temporal correlations to efficiently learn evolving graph structures. Experimental results on synthetic and real-world datasets demonstrate that the proposed algorithm achieves competitive accuracy compared to centralized methods and outperforms existing distributed approaches.
